Re: Toyota Innova | Type 2 to Type 4 facelift conversion

One of my friends had converted his 2008 Innova to type 4 in 2017 at Nandi Toyota at Bangalore when his car had a rear shunt. There are many garages who does the Type 1 to Type 4 conversion. I think both the dealers in Kerala i.e Nippon Toyota & Amana Toyota does this conversion as I have seen posts by both AutoStarke and PerfAmana ( both of these are owned by Nippon and Amana group respectively) on this type 1 to type 4 conversion.
If you are looking at aftermarket options, there is a wholesaler in my town who sells this type 4 conversion kit with imported parts and also facilitate conversion excluding painting in a day.
